a| This reconstruction of the October Revolution was made in celebration of its 10th anniversary. It was later renamed "Ten Days That Shook the World", after the famous book written by John Reed. The film commemorates the historical period from the fall of tsarism to the October Revolution. It became canonized as an 'official version' of the events. An exemplary case of 'intellectual montage' cinema.
